hCT(9-32) 是一种人降钙素 (hCT) 衍生的细胞穿透肽,已被证明可以转移哺乳动物细胞的质膜。
hCT(9-32) is a human calcitonin (hCT)-derived cell-penetrating peptide that has been shown totranslocate the plasma membrane of mammalian cells.
它是一种细胞穿透肽(CPP),来源于人钙蛋白序列。它具有良好的蛋白水解抗性,并且在低微摩尔浓度下可以渗透细胞膜而没有显著影响。hCT可以与大分子偶联并用作药物递送载体。
It is a cell-penetrating peptide (CPP) derived from the human calcitotnin protein sequence. It has good proteolytic resistance and can permeate cell membrane without significant influence at low micromolar concentration. hCT can be conjugated with large molecules and used as a drug delivery vehicle.
